Rooted in diverse cultures and traditions across the continent, African cuisine is a treasure trove of flavors, spices, and cooking techniques. From the aromatic tagines of Morocco to the fiery jollof rice of West Africa, each dish tells a story of history and heritage. Exploring African cuisine can be an enriching experience, allowing you to not only tantalize your taste buds but also gain insights into the vibrant tapestry of cultures that make up the continent. Now, let's pivot to project management. Project management is all about planning, organizing, and executing tasks to achieve specific goals. Whether you are overseeing a construction project, launching a new product, or organizing a cultural event, effective project management is essential for success. Just like a chef orchestrates the perfect balance of ingredients in a dish, a project manager skillfully coordinates resources, timelines, and teams to deliver results.
